I've lived in several areas and as far as I can see, pikelets and crumpets are the same thing in England. However, in Scotland, a crumpet - at least in my youth - was like a thin pancake, about the dimensions of a tea plate but with holes in one surface like an English crumpet/pikelet. It was spread with butter and jam and rolled up.
